Anyways, here is the scrubber about half done. The top part will be the "water box", and will consist of a water tight chamber fed by a 1/2" bulkhead from one of the sides, that water will run through the holes you see there onto a piece of lexan that holds screen on both sides, then will run right into a fuge. All I need to do is make the inside piece, remake the two ends for the water box, and then some sort of locking thing so the middle algae sheet stays in place. I wanted to be able to remove the whole center if need be so that you can clean it out whenever you wanted to. ![]() I am also making a holder for it so that it rests right above the fuge, just waiting on the dimensions of the fuge for that one. I'm looking for something just like the one demoed in the video on Acrylic Overflow Aquarium When I said 4 sides I meant all 4 sides plus a bottom. Basically a sturdy acrylic box with a hole in it, which instead of siliconing or gluing the overflow to the tank, I could just attach it to my bulkhead. The main benefits being I can take it out of the tank to clean it (I have an acrylic tank that doesn't have a totally open tank, limiting the ability to get into a small overflow) and since my tank isn't 100% level I can slightly tinker with the angle of the overflow, without being tied to it permanently being crooked.
